Obituary of Geane Martin King

Geane King, 93, of Fort Worth, Texas passed away on September 17, 2021. Geane Martin King was born in Slaton, Texas on January 10, 1928. After her family homesteaded in New Mexico for a brief time, the family returned to Slaton where Geane graduated from Slaton High School in 1944. She then attended Texas Tech University in Lubbock, Texas where she graduated in May of 1949 receiving a Bachelor of Science in Home Economics degree with a major in Applied Arts and two semesters in Architecture. Geane married Kenneth R. King on July 23,1949. They made their home in Odessa, Texas where Kenneth and his dad had a construction company. Geane and Kenneth were active members of First Baptist Church in Odessa, Texas where Geane sang in the adult choir and worked with children’s choirs. In 1963, after her four children were older, Geane began substitute teaching. After substituting for 5 years, she began teaching full time as a sixth-grade teacher in Odessa. In 1973, the family moved to Austin, Texas. While in Austin, Geane and Kenneth attended Hyde Park Baptist Church, and Geane continued her career as an educator with Del Valle ISD until she retired in 1991. She loved playing bridge, flower arranging, home décor, and anything related to arts and crafts. She also enjoyed studying and researching her family’s genealogy. After retiring, Geane and Kenneth enjoyed travelling throughout the lower forty-eight United States and Mexico in their RV, resulting in many new life-long friendships. Following the death of Kenneth in 2006, Geane remained in Austin for (2) more years before moving to Fort Worth in 2008 to be closer to family. Over the next (13) years, she enjoyed living at the Brookdale Independent Living Community and The Ridglea Assisted Living facilities in Fort Worth. Geane was preceded in death by her husband of (57) years, Kenneth (Kirby) King in August of 2006, and her son John Ross King in March of 2017. She is survived by her son Bruce King and wife Wendy of Fort Worth; daughter Vivian Roberts and husband John of Bedford; daughter Stacy McKillop and husband Steve of Canby, OR; grandchildren Jennifer King, Jeff King, Alicia Mitchell, Steven Wood, and Kyra McKillop; and great grandchildren Charlotte King, Peyton King, and Jameson Mitchell.
